Chapter 57
Seraphina desperately suppressed the anger that was boiling up inside her.
The moment she lost her temper here, everything would fall apart.
Everyone would condemn Seraphina as being overly sensitive.
They would mock and ridicule her for losing her composure, trampling her into the ground.
So even if her feet were on fire, she had to pretend to maintain the most relaxed expression and attitude possible.
“Speaking of which, I heard Lady Ansi has been attending the Watkins Reading Group with Lady Claudius recently?”
‘Watkins? That bookworm gathering?’
Seraphina raised one eyebrow.
Wasn’t that the very gathering that she herself, as well as the members of ‘Peony,’ had subtly looked down upon?
But when Lady Claudius’s name was added to that gathering.
“My goodness, I want to go too!”
“Reading, how intellectually appealing!”
That reading group was instantly elevated to a gathering that everyone ‘desperately wanted to join.’
And that situation became a sharp arrow, shooting toward Seraphina once again.
“By any chance, wasn’t Lady Lopez invited this time either?”
…Why are they suddenly bringing up that topic?
Seraphina felt an ominous feeling.
And that feeling proved correct.
“Well, I’ve decided to attend starting from the next meeting.”
Lady Sanchez, who had been forced to become second-in-command of the ‘Peony’ social gathering due to being overshadowed by Seraphina.
She triumphantly held up an invitation to the Watkins Reading Group.
“Actually, I wasn’t particularly interested before, but Lady Claudius has been quite active in high society lately, hasn’t she?”
Lady Sanchez smiled sweetly with her eyes.
“I really want to meet Lady Claudius at least once, and my mother and Countess Sherwood are close friends. So I received an invitation through my mother this time.”
“Oh my, I’m so envious!”
“I really want to go too. Could you somehow invite me later as well?”
The ladies of the gathering each looked at Lady Sanchez with envious expressions.
“Of course. What is friendship for?”
Lady Sanchez shrugged her shoulders and gazed at Seraphina with eyes full of triumph.
“Oh, just in case, let me mention this beforehand. Lady Lopez might be a bit… difficult.”
“…”
Seraphina’s gaze turned coldly dark.
Lady Sanchez pretended to be cautious while scratching at Seraphina once more.
“After all, we have to consider Lady Claudius’s feelings. You understand, don’t you?”
“Don’t worry. I never had any intention of asking for an invitation in the first place.”
Seraphina smiled beautifully like a lily in bloom.
“That would be rather… childish, wouldn’t it?”
Of course, Seraphina had once asked Larite to invite her to the Salon at the Claudius Estate.
But Seraphina tried to erase that memory and put on as much bravado as possible.
“Rather, I’m curious about Lady Sanchez’s intentions.”
“My intentions?”
“Of course. I never even thought of asking in the first place, so why are you making such a point of targeting me?”
Actually, the best response would have been to end it at ‘childish, wouldn’t it?’
But Seraphina was so irritated that she added one more comment.
“Oh my, were you perhaps hurt?”
Lady Sanchez didn’t miss the opportunity and widened her eyes, painting Seraphina as a petty person.
“I was just trying to be considerate in case Lady Lopez might misunderstand. I’m sorry if I offended you.”
“Lady Sanchez, that’s…”
“How should I put it, I was worried you might feel somewhat isolated.”
Lady Sanchez smiled brightly.
“I forgot that Lady Lopez is such a noble person. Of course you wouldn’t need such trivial invitations… I made assumptions.”
Although her voice was as soft as down feathers, the content was full of thorns.
“You’ve been particularly quiet today, so I was worried that perhaps your feelings were hurt. I guess I was mistaken.”
“…”
Seraphina kept her smiling face while gritting her teeth.
‘I made a mistake.’
She shouldn’t have given Lady Sanchez any opening to find fault with.
‘…How irritating, really.’
If it were the usual Lady Sanchez, she wouldn’t have dared to chatter so freely, being too busy reading Seraphina’s mood.
But today she was leading the conversation in Seraphina’s place.
That itself was proof that Seraphina had lost control of this gathering.
Seraphina felt even more dejected.
“Speaking of which, hasn’t Lady Claudius’s atmosphere become a bit softer recently?”
“That’s right. She smiles much more than before too.”
“Before, it felt difficult to even approach her, but lately it’s not like that.”
“I happened to run into Lady Claudius recently, and she actually greeted me first.”
The ladies who once gossiped about Seraphina and Lady Claudius had flipped their attitudes like turning over their palms, now taking Lady Claudius’s side.
Moreover.
“Lady Lopez always said Lady Claudius was cold, so we thought that was the case.”
“That might have been our prejudice after all.”
…They even subtly pushed all that gossip onto Seraphina’s responsibility.
‘Endure it.’
Seraphina closed her eyes tightly and composed herself.
At least she still had influence in this gathering, so she had to stay attached as much as possible.
One of Seraphina’s biggest foundations was ‘Peony.’
For now, the best strategy was to consistently show her face at the meetings while looking for an opportunity to somehow push out Lady Sanchez.
She no longer had Larite to use, and the House of Lopez was too humble to provide any help.
Also, Gregory had been cold to her recently…
‘Gregory.’
Thinking of that name, Seraphina felt her breath catch.
And for good reason.
‘Lately Gregory seems to be avoiding me.’
Since the incident in the Southern Region, Gregory seemed to have completely lost interest in Seraphina.
Before, he used to visit Seraphina so often that the threshold wore thin, but lately his visits had completely stopped.
Unable to bear it any longer, when Seraphina finally went to visit Gregory herself.
“Sera, what brings you here?”
He clearly showed his lack of interest in Seraphina.
“Didn’t Larite come with you?”
…The devastation of hearing those words to her face.
And that wasn’t all?
He would seat Seraphina beside him, then become lost in other thoughts in a daze.
Or he would frequently leave Seraphina alone and step away.
If not that, then,
“Sera, have you heard anything about Larite lately?”
He would only ask detailed questions about Larite.
‘No, I must be imagining things.’
Seraphina clenched her fists tightly.
Just Larite attaching herself to Lady Claudius was already such a huge blow.
If she lost Gregory on top of that…
‘That absolutely cannot happen.’
She didn’t even want to imagine it.
* * *
The time when the sun was slowly setting.
The gathering finally came to an end.
“Today was really enjoyable, Lady Sanchez!”
“See you again!”
The ladies exchanged warm farewells.
Seraphina, who had remained until the very end, finally relaxed a little.
‘I need to go back and rest quickly.’
Having sat under the ladies’ piercing gazes all day, her entire body had stiffened.
Her lips, which had been forcing a smile, were almost cramping.
But then.
“Oh my.”
Covering her mouth with her fully opened fan, Lady Sanchez smiled with her eyes.
“Gusto Youngshik isn’t here today?”
“…”
Caught off guard by the sudden attack, Seraphina swallowed nervously.
Lady Sanchez continued speaking while gently waving her fan.
“Usually, Gusto Youngshik would always come to pick up Lady Lopez.”
“…That’s.”
“He would even take care of Lady Lopez before Lady Ansi, his own fiancée, wouldn’t he?”
Lady Sanchez’s smile deepened slightly.
“Whenever I saw that, I thought ‘Lady Lopez is truly loved’— and I was envious.”
Having said that, Lady Sanchez looked Seraphina up and down with eyes full of mockery.
Seraphina felt her face burning hot.
Lady Sanchez snapped her fan shut with a sharp sound and shrugged her shoulders smugly.
“Well then, get home safely, Lady Lopez.”
And so the ladies disappeared, each boarding their family’s carriage.
Seraphina climbed into her carriage as if fleeing.
